A staggering 19.6 percent of US office spaces is unoccupied- the emptiest they've been in the last 40 years. The drastic shift has spiked due to impacts from the pandemic, work-from-home lifestyle, years of overbuilding and the office-market decline of the 1980s and 90s, according to .Office spaces in major US cities weren't leased at the end of the fourth quarter and the amount of vacant spaces has gone up 18.8 percent compared to last year, according to Moody's Analytics.
